Kylarrick House Airstrip is a small airport in Scotland, United Kingdom. The airport is located at latitude 57.81723 and longitude -4.17384. The airport has one runway: 2/20. This airport has no ICAO code, we use GB-0867 as reference. The airport is in the Scottish FIR.
